Media sanitization policies are a critical component of information security. As technology changes, organizations must review policy and process to ensure that it is still effective. Solid state drives require extra attention.

“Degaussing, a fundamental way to sanitize magnetic media, no longer applies in most cases for flash memory-based devices. Evolutionary changes in magnetic media will also have potential impacts on sanitization. New storage technologies, and even variations of magnetic storage, that are dramatically different from legacy magnetic media will clearly require sanitization research and require a reinvestigation of sanitization procedures to ensure efficacy.” — NIST Special Publication 800-88 Revision 1 Section 2.3
